Given:

Height of cylinder, h = 9 cm

Radius, r = 3 cm

Total amount of paper the company has = 8138.88 cm²

Let's find the number of labels that can be made given that the label covers only the side.

Here, we are to apply the formula for the surface area of a cylinder.

We have:

SA=2\pi rh+2\pi r^2

The 2πr² represents the area of the top and bottom circle of the cylinder.

Since the label covers only the side, we are to exclude the 2πr².

Hence. we have:

SA_{label}=2\pi rh

WHere:

r = 3 cm

h = 9 cm

Thus, we have:

\begin{gathered} SA_{label}=2*3.14*3*9 \\  \\ SA_{label}=169.56\text{ cm}^2 \end{gathered}

Now, the number of labels they can make is:

\begin{gathered} \text{ number of labels = }\frac{8138.88\text{ cm}^2}{169.56\text{ cm}^2} \\  \\ \text{ number of labels = 48} \end{gathered}

Therefore, the company can make 48 labels.

ANSWER:

48 Labels

Why is 5 to the 2 power also read as 5 squared
Vikki [24]

The reason for this has to do with finding the area of a square. When you are looking for the area of a square, you use the rectangle formula (since a square is also a rectangle).

The formula is Area = Length * Width

However, since in a square, the length and width are the same, both get changed to the word "Side". As a result, we get the following formula.

Area = Side * Side

This can be simplified to:

Area = Side^2.

Since each number to the second power also shows the area of a square with that given length sides, it can also be called "squared".
